Enrolment in secondary education, both sexes in Jamaica
Jamaica: Enrolment in secondary education, both sexes was 177,095 in 2024. ▼ Falling
Enrolment in secondary education, both sexes in Jamaica, 1973–2024
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ics.
Analysis
The most recent figure for enrolment in secondary education, both sexes in Jamaica is 177,095, measured in 2024.
That represents a change of down 4.2% on the previous year and down 20.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, enrolment in secondary education, both sexes in Jamaica peaked at 266,933 in 2009 and was at its lowest, 158,661, in 1974.
That places Jamaica 136th out of 219 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 42 years of available data.
Enrolment in secondary education, both sexes in Jamaica, year by year
| Year | Value |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 1973 | 165,614 | — |
| 1974 | 158,661 | -4.2% |
| 1975 | 196,605 | +23.9% |
| 1976 | 216,248 | +10.0% |
| 1977 | 225,741 | +4.4% |
| 1979 | 239,759 | +6.2% |
| 1980 | 255,231 | +6.5% |
| 1981 | 248,001 | -2.8% |
| 1982 | 238,063 | -4.0% |
| 1983 | 242,389 | +1.8% |
| 1984 | 237,758 | -1.9% |
| 1985 | 243,575 | +2.4% |
| 1986 | 237,713 | -2.4% |
| 1987 | 236,391 | -0.6% |
| 1988 | 247,499 | +4.7% |
| 1989 | 241,000 | -2.6% |
| 1991 | 252,070 | +4.6% |
| 1993 | 235,071 | -6.7% |
| 1999 | 231,177 | -1.7% |
| 2000 | 228,764 | -1.0% |
| 2001 | 227,703 | -0.5% |
| 2002 | 228,316 | +0.3% |
| 2003 | 229,701 | +0.6% |
| 2004 | 245,533 | +6.9% |
| 2005 | 246,332 | +0.3% |
| 2007 | 257,186 | +4.4% |
| 2008 | 262,608 | +2.1% |
| 2009 | 266,933 | +1.6% |
| 2010 | 260,371 | -2.5% |
| 2011 | 249,663 | -4.1% |
| 2013 | 228,624 | -8.4% |
| 2014 | 223,920 | -2.1% |
| 2015 | 215,200 | -3.9% |
| 2016 | 216,813 | +0.7% |
| 2017 | 204,080 | -5.9% |
| 2018 | 200,563 | -1.7% |
| 2019 | 202,717 | +1.1% |
| 2020 | 189,500 | -6.5% |
| 2021 | 195,611 | +3.2% |
| 2022 | 184,404 | -5.7% |
| 2023 | 184,800 | +0.2% |
| 2024 | 177,095 | -4.2% |
